Ex-Armed Forces personnel and their family members are invited to drop in for a brew at the new Help for Heroes cafés across Devon. 

These cafés enable the local Armed Forces community to come together, meet new people and find out what support is available from Help for Heroes.

The charity is determined to get more people across Devon the help they need, whenever or wherever they served in the military. 

The next free Help for Heroes café is open on Wednesday, 3 April (1.30pm), at Cranford Sports Club, Exmouth (EX8 2EQ). 

The following week, on Thursday, 11 April (10.30am), the café moves to Barnstaple RFC, Pottington Road, (EX31 1JH), before rolling up again a week later, on Wednesday, 17 April (10am), at Paignton RFC, Queen’s Park (TQ4 6AT).

Its final stopping-off point for the month is at Wolseley Trust, Plymouth (PL2 3BY), on Friday, 19 April (10am).
